**Runbook: Plumline profile-store shard recovery**

Support team: when a Plumline user-profile shard is rebalanced, some accounts may show as "orphaned" until the directory refreshes. Do not recreate these accounts. Instead, open the Shardkeeper console, locate the affected shard, and trigger a directory reconciliation. The console will refuse the reconciliation until you supply the recovery passphrase for the shard-admin account, which is kept on the line below.

recovery phrase for kawig-yadug: fenath-eliox-tammir

## Runbook: Static-analysis baseline drift

If the Lintmoor pipeline starts failing on files nobody touched, the baseline file is probably stale. The baseline pins known findings so only new issues block merges; a tool upgrade can reclassify old findings and break it. Do not regenerate the baseline blindly — that can mask real regressions. Follow the controlled-regen procedure instead, and note the tool version in the commit. The procedure is documented here.

operations page: https://jenkins.zemvarcloud.local/job/merge_requests/repo/build/73930b4b30f0a8ed

### CSV import stalls at "Validating rows"

Symptom: GridLoad wizard hangs after header mapping. Cause: the Tabulon validation service rejects unauthenticated chunk uploads silently; the wizard retries forever instead of surfacing the 401. Fix: confirm the wizard's service account token hasn't expired (90-day rotation), then restart the import. To reproduce manually, POST a sample chunk to the staging validator endpoint. Every request must include an Authorization header carrying the staging bearer token shown below.

portal login ticket: eyJhbGciOiJIUzI1NiIsInR5cCI6IkpXVCJ9.eyJzdWIiOiIwEOsktwVNwIn0.-UJU3fdyyCgG